Fred Garbo admits that the Fred Garbo Inflatable Theater Company is hard to describe. He is a mime, after all. But not a white-faced, striped-shirt-wearing-clown-who-opens-imaginary-doors kinda mime. Garbo brings gigantic inflatable props to life onstage, and he's one of 50 artists participating in Playhouse Square's Centerfest performing arts festival on Saturday.

After playing Barkley, Sesame Street's resident dog, for eight seasons, Garbo hooked up with a hot-air-balloon craftsman, who designed costumes out of lightweight nylon fabric -- the same stuff parachutes are made of. "It's obvious to the audience that there's a person inside the inflatables," he says. "It's how you bring them to life that's fun." Garbo and partner Daielma Santos do more than just float -- they perform balloon-clad acrobatics. "At the end of the show, we do a pas de blimp," he boasts. Centerfest -- which also includes dance performances, craft booths, and a sneak peek at upcoming stage shows -- takes place from noon to 5 p.m. at Playhouse Square Center (1501 Euclid Avenue).
